dc.description.abstractIn this study, we develop a companion robot function that can recognize people and obstacles, and track the human target while avoiding the obstacles. In implementing the JetBot tracking function, a deep learning-based object detection model is modified and utilized. A transfer learning algorithm with a pretrained mobile model is introduced for a feasible operation in the proposed framework with mobile robots.-
